kernel: serial: protect uart_port_dtr_rts() in uart_shutdown() too

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el's serial subsystem. This vulnerability occurs in the uartshutdown function, where a null pointer dereference can happen if the HUPCL flag is set. A local attacker could potentially exploit this flaw to cause a system crash, leading to a Denial of Service DoS...

kernel: USB: serial: quatech2: fix null-ptr-deref in qt2_process_read_urb()

A flaw was found in the quatech2 module in the Linux kernel. An incorrect check for invalid port numbers can cause a NULL pointer dereference and result in a denial of service...
